Ontology-based Privacy Preserving Digital Forensics Framework

Along with the rapid growth of the number of intelligent mobile devices as well as applications in recent years owing to the development of network information and telecommunication technologies, personal privacy faces a unprecedented level of risk. This seems to be especially inevitable in digital forensic investigations. Consequently, there is an urgent need to balance the desire for privacy preservation and information extraction in the process of digital forensic investigations. This paper focuses on the issues related to personal privacy protection by proposing a digital forensics framework based on the theory of ontology. In addition to introducing the basic concepts that will lead to the establishment of the framework, we will also present some experiments that can be viewed as the demonstration of the effectiveness of the framework in privacy protection in the process of digital forensic investigations. The framework can thus serve as the foundation in the design of digital forensic tools and systems that can respect the privacy of individuals.
